Skip to Content

Understanding Yield Prediction

Understanding Yield Prediction: A Comprehensive Guide for Beginners

What is Yield Prediction?

Definition of Yield Prediction

Yield prediction refers to the process of forecasting the output or performance of a system, such as agricultural crops, financial investments, or manufacturing processes. It involves using historical data and statistical models to estimate future outcomes.

Key Terms

  • Yield: The amount of product or output generated by a system.
  • Prediction: The act of forecasting future events or outcomes based on data.
  • Model: A mathematical representation used to simulate and predict system behavior.

Examples of Yield Prediction in Different Fields

  • Agriculture: Predicting crop yields based on weather, soil conditions, and farming practices.
  • Finance: Estimating investment returns and managing risks.
  • Manufacturing: Forecasting production output to optimize resources.

Why is Yield Prediction Important?

Agriculture: Resource Planning and Food Security

Yield prediction helps farmers plan resources effectively, ensuring food security and sustainable farming practices.

Finance: Investment Returns and Risk Management

In finance, yield prediction is crucial for estimating returns on investments and managing risks associated with market fluctuations.

Manufacturing: Production Optimization

Manufacturers use yield prediction to forecast production output, enabling better resource allocation and minimizing waste.

Data Science: Model Performance Estimation

Data scientists rely on yield prediction to estimate the performance of machine learning models, ensuring accurate and reliable predictions.

How Does Yield Prediction Work?

Data Collection: Gathering Relevant Data

The first step involves collecting historical data relevant to the system being analyzed, such as weather data for agriculture or financial data for investments.

Data Preprocessing: Cleaning and Organizing Data

Data preprocessing ensures that the collected data is clean, organized, and ready for analysis. This step may involve handling missing values, removing outliers, and normalizing data.

Feature Selection: Identifying Key Variables

Feature selection involves identifying the most relevant variables that influence the yield. For example, in agriculture, key variables might include rainfall, temperature, and soil quality.

Model Building: Creating Mathematical Representations

A mathematical model is created to represent the relationship between the input variables and the yield. Common models include linear regression, decision trees, and neural networks.

Training the Model: Learning from Historical Data

The model is trained using historical data to learn the patterns and relationships between the input variables and the yield.

Validation and Testing: Ensuring Model Accuracy

The model's accuracy is validated and tested using a separate dataset to ensure it can make reliable predictions.

Prediction: Forecasting Future Yields

Once validated, the model is used to predict future yields based on new input data.

Practical Example: Predicting Crop Yield

Step 1: Data Collection - Gathering Weather, Soil, and Crop Data

Collect data on weather conditions, soil properties, and historical crop yields.

Step 2: Data Preprocessing - Cleaning and Preparing Data

Clean the data by handling missing values, removing outliers, and normalizing the data.

Step 3: Feature Selection - Choosing Key Variables

Identify key variables such as rainfall, temperature, and soil pH that influence crop yield.

Step 4: Model Building - Selecting a Linear Regression Model

Choose a linear regression model to represent the relationship between the input variables and crop yield.

Step 5: Training the Model - Using Historical Data

Train the model using historical crop yield data to learn the patterns and relationships.

Step 6: Validation and Testing - Testing with Recent Data

Validate the model's accuracy using recent crop yield data to ensure reliable predictions.

Step 7: Prediction - Forecasting Future Crop Yields

Use the trained model to predict future crop yields based on new weather and soil data.

Challenges in Yield Prediction

Data Quality: Importance of Accurate and Complete Data

Accurate and complete data is crucial for reliable yield predictions. Poor data quality can lead to inaccurate forecasts.

Complex Relationships: Interacting Variables and Their Impact

The relationships between variables can be complex and non-linear, making it challenging to model accurately.

Unpredictable Factors: External Influences Like Weather Events

External factors such as weather events can significantly impact yield predictions, introducing uncertainty.

Model Limitations: Handling New or Unexpected Scenarios

Models may struggle to handle new or unexpected scenarios, leading to inaccurate predictions.

Tools and Techniques for Yield Prediction

Machine Learning: Algorithms for Complex Data Analysis

Machine learning algorithms, such as decision trees and neural networks, are used to analyze complex data and make accurate predictions.

Remote Sensing: Using Satellites and Drones for Data Collection

Remote sensing technologies, including satellites and drones, are used to collect large-scale data for yield prediction.

Geographic Information Systems (GIS): Mapping and Analyzing Spatial Data

GIS tools are used to map and analyze spatial data, providing valuable insights for yield prediction.

Simulation Models: Mimicking Real-World Systems for Predictions

Simulation models mimic real-world systems to predict yields under different scenarios.

Real-World Applications of Yield Prediction

Precision Agriculture: Optimizing Farming Practices

Yield prediction is used in precision agriculture to optimize farming practices, reduce waste, and increase productivity.

Investment Planning: Estimating Returns on Investments

In finance, yield prediction helps investors estimate returns on investments and manage risks.

Supply Chain Management: Forecasting Production Output

Manufacturers use yield prediction to forecast production output, enabling better supply chain management.

Climate Change Research: Studying Impacts on Agriculture

Yield prediction is used in climate change research to study the impacts of changing weather patterns on agriculture.

Conclusion

Recap of Yield Prediction Basics

Yield prediction involves forecasting system outputs using historical data and statistical models.

Importance of Understanding the Process and Challenges

Understanding the process and challenges of yield prediction is crucial for accurate and reliable forecasts.

Encouragement to Explore Further Applications and Tools

We encourage learners to explore further applications and tools in yield prediction to deepen their understanding and skills.

Key Takeaways

  • Yield prediction involves forecasting system outputs.
  • Applications in agriculture, finance, manufacturing, and data science.
  • Process includes data collection, model building, and prediction.
  • Challenges include data quality and unpredictable factors.
  • Tools like machine learning and GIS support yield prediction.

This comprehensive guide provides a clear and structured overview of yield prediction, tailored for beginners. Each section builds logically on the previous one, ensuring a thorough understanding of the topic. The use of bullet points and clear headings enhances readability, making the content accessible and engaging for learners.

Rating
1 0

There are no comments for now.

to be the first to leave a comment.